Deputy Sheriff Albert Pike Powell
Rogers County Sheriff's Office
Oklahoma

End of Watch: Sunday, February 4, 1934

Biographical Info
Age: 58
Tour of Duty: 1 year
Badge Number: Not available

Incident Details
Cause of Death: Gunfire
Date of Incident: Sunday, February 4, 1934
Weapon Used: Handgun
Suspect Info: Not available

Deputy Powell was shot and killed as he and the Chelsea city marshal investigated two suspicious men. The two officers were patrolling together when they observed the two men walking away from a local hardware store. The city marshal turned the car around and as they came close the two men opened fire, killing Deputy Powell.

Deputy Powell had served with the Rogers County Sheriff's Office for 1 year.
